Seeing as Switzerland was conquered by the french in 1789 and was under their rule for twenty odd years, they aren't the oldest democracy as that was only established in 1815 if we're going to get all ****ing pedantic.

Not to mention the fact that the Swiss confederation expanded back then and isn't the same country that it is today (geographically speaking) by a long shot.

Or that many of the swiss cantons were ruled by the local aristocracies, notably the Bern canton until the french invasion, the bale cantons which were ruled so oppressively that revolt broke out and the original canton was forced to split. What's funny about Switzerland is that some of the current cantons were invaded and ruled by decree by the other ones. That and the fact it took Napoleon to unite most of the final cantons in his Act of Mediation.
